Understanding the Regulatory Landscape in Australia

The Australian gambling market is heavily regulated, and for good reason.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) is the cornerstone of online gambling legislation, but it’s not always straightforward. Understanding the specifics of the IGA and its implications is paramount. The Act prohibits online casinos from operating within Australia, which means that Australian players typically access offshore platforms. This creates a complex legal environment, and it is essential to understand the implications of playing on these platforms.

Mastering Game Selection and Strategy

The range of games available online is vast, from classic table games like blackjack and roulette to a plethora of slots and video poker variations. Choosing the right games and employing the correct strategies is crucial for long-term success. For example, in blackjack, understanding basic strategy and card counting (where permitted) can significantly reduce the house edge. In video poker, mastering the optimal strategy for each game variation can lead to positive expected value.
